How urgent is water damage mitigation?
The microbial amplification window is 48–72 hours post-intrusion in our climate. Insurance protocols in 2026 explicitly document this timeline. If professional mitigation does not begin within this window, liability for subsequent mold remediation may shift from the 'sudden and accidental' water loss claim to a maintenance exclusion, creating significant coverage complications.

My insurance says it's 'grey water.' What does that mean for my claim?
Category 2 'grey water' contains significant chemical or biological contaminants from appliances or plumbing fixtures. It is distinct from clean Category 1 water and hazardous Category 3 'black water.' Proper categorization dictates the remediation protocol. What should I do the moment I discover a major leak?
Immediate water shut-off is the first step in mitigating 'loss of use.' Locate your main shut-off valve. For homes near Martha Lake Park with similar utility layouts, PUD of Snohomish County should be contacted for emergency street-side shut-off if the interior valve fails. This single action limits water volume and category severity, directly impacting restoration cost and duration.

The floor feels dry. Why do you need to run dehumidifiers for days?
Surface dryness is deceptive. The S500 standard of care requires drying to a psychrometric equilibrium, not just to the touch. In Martha Lake, we target an interior vapor pressure of 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. Subfloor materials and concrete slabs retain moisture that migrates upward as vapor, leading to secondary damage if not actively removed with industrial-grade refrigerant dehumidifiers.
